
IRS sending October installment of child tax credit after delay in September
CHICAGO (NewsNation Now) — Family members throughout the country are commencing to receive their October kid tax credit score.
The IRS says the program’s fourth month to month payment is presently hitting Americans’ financial institution accounts soon after a technical difficulty previous month prompted delays for some recipients.
Some families in want stated the checks have been a preserving grace during the pandemic.
The Oct payment totaled around $15 billion and is envisioned to achieve 36 million family members and effect about 61 million children, in accordance to the IRS.
The ripple results of the pandemic crippled many Individuals economically. Now, less than the Biden administration’s “American Rescue System,” people families battling amid the pandemic are eligible for a child tax credit score.
Families with children under 6 several years aged will acquire $300 for each kid. Individuals with small children ages 6 to 17 can assume $250 for each child. Men and women earning a lot less than $75,000 and married partners earning much less than $150,000 qualify.
Two more payments nonetheless remain in the system. They are predicted to arrive on Nov. 15 and Dec. 15.
Opponents of the tax credit history say it places the government additional in personal debt and gives out funds, which they argue, deters persons from getting do the job.
Mother and father have the proper to choose out at any time.
